Scientific theory is the explanation of nature base on repetition of observing facts. It had to withstand scientific review to re-examine all the time. Scientific theory is certain thing in layman term and context. However, statistically, nothing is 100% certain and possibly a tiny possibility exist that it is wrong or had limit in certain area.

Some would try to use theory as the mean of uncertain to make believe scientific theory is the same as personal theory. Scientific theory to withstand require certainty as it must provide thoroughly along the path of experimental result. The personal theory is what called in science a hypothesis.

Is it true that A scientific theory is a statement that describes what scientists expect to happen every time under certain conditions?

A scientific theory presents an explanation for a phenomenon. Using that explanation, one can then make predictions about what will happen under certain conditions. But the prediction is not the theory, it is a implication of the theory.
